The process of ACC vehicle running in the curve is divided into three kinds of working conditions: Enter the Curve, In the Curve and Come off the Curve. Based on the prediction of lane radius, the ACC system operating mode switching logic is designed, and vehicle track radius is used to identify the target vehicle in the front. The feasibility of curve target recognition algorithm and switching logic is verified by simulation.
